Earl Max Johnson , age 80, of Salt Lake City, UT, passed away peacefully on Monday, July 3, 2006 in Salt Lake City, UT. Earl was born November 11, 1925 in Provo, UT to William Earl Johnson and Thelma Carter. He was drafted into the Marine Corps during his senior year in high school where he served in the South Pacific. He was a personal bodyguard to Admiral Nimitz. He was the Founder of Metropolitan Financial. Earl was a true and faithful member of The Church of Jesus Christ wherein he held many church positions. He was a devoted husband, father and grandfather. Survivors include his wife, LaDonna Thorne Johnson of Salt Lake City, Utah; sons: Craig (Judy), David (Robin), former daughter-in-law Susan Johnson, six grandchildren and one great-grandchild. Preceded in death by his parents, brother Bill, and son Douglas Earl Johnson.
